Can you buy a 1 year warranty for a used PS3?

i was going to get a used backwards compatible ps3 from Gamestop but i don’t know the 1 year warranty is already up. can i some how buy a warranty and if so, how? and where do i buy it at?

You cannot buy a 1 year warranty for a USED PS3 from Sony. If you think of this from Sony’s point of view, you will understand. Sony only honor the warranty to the original buyer and only 1 year.

http://www.us.playstation.com/Support/Warranties/PS3

You can get some kind of guarantee from Gamestop for about 2 weeks or so. That is, if the machine does not work, you can return it within 2 weeks, I believe. However, gamestop do not sell or honor any long term warranty.

Unfortunately, no organization will sell warranty to a used PS3.

Was he Verica in Southern England?

Some years ago a treasure seeker detected some metal on one of our local landmarks. It was on a hill generally called ‘Sugarloaf Hill’,and he dug up a silver coin. On one side was a head of a man and on the other side~a galloping horse. Could the man’s head represent ‘Verica’~a Romano/British ruler made in charge of the Britons in Southern England?
It could’nt be Verica…..perhaps ‘Eppilus’

There are several numismatic (coin) sites on the web which illustrate known coins of Verica. They feature a mounted man, a vine leaf, an abstract star design, a bird, a male wearing a Roman toga and a “butting” bull. For an example see:

http://www.kernunnos.com/celticcoins/Atrabetes%20Images/verica_bull..html

None of the designs are as you describe, but coins with heads on one side and a stylised horse on the other were extremely common among the pre-Roman Celts. Your coin could have been minted just before or just after the Roman invasion, but it is not likely to be a coin of Verica as it does not follow any known pattern.

If there is any lettering on the coin, this is often a shortened version of the king’s name.
